Your Committee on Human Services and Housing, to which was referred H.B. No. 78 entitled:

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O THE HOUSING AND CO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T CORPORATION OF HAWAII,"

begs leave to report as follows:

The purpose of this bill is to make the administration of the federal housing programs more efficient by authorizing the Housing and Community Development Corporation of Hawaii (HCDCH) to establish and maintain special fund accounts outside of the state treasury.

HCDCH testified in support of this bill.

Your Committee finds that the establishment and management of fund accounts that are separate from the state treasury are necessary for the effective administration of federal housing programs, including federal low-rent public housing, section 8 housing choice vouchers, emergency shelter grants, and housing for persons with AIDS.

As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Human Services and Housing that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 78 and recommends that it pass Second Reading and be referred to the Committee on Finance.
